TurboTax 2023 Entries on S-Corp DIssolution Actions

Hello, I am having difficulty in entering, in the right places, the information needed to record, in Form 1120-S, the dissolution of my S-Corp.  I am also recording the distribution of remaining equity to the sole Shareholder.

Among the pages I have worked with are:
* the TurboTax Business Schedule K-1 Worksheet,
* Schedule K-1, and
* the Weighted Average Ownership Percentage Worksheet. 

 

It looks like I need to:

1. Record the Distribution of Assets (within Basis); I think that should be done on the Schedule K-1 Worksheet, in the section titled "Distributions from Schedule K Line 16d". Is that correct? That entry travelled correctly to Schedule K-1.
2. For the Dissolution, it appeared to be merely changing the End of year No. of shares from 100 to 0. But TurboTax Business will not let me do that, on any of the forms I have looked at. And, on the Schedule K-1 Worksheet, I also recorded 0 (zero) near the bottom of the form in the Total number of shareholders at year end. That did not do anything on the K-1. 

I have not been able to find anything about this second issue in the usually-helpful right-click information for these entries.
